Abstract

In this paper a simulation model for visual attention is discussed and formally analysed. The model is part of the design of a cognitive system which comprises an agent that supports a naval officer in its task to compile a tactical picture of the situation in the field. A case study is described in which the model is used to simulate a human subject's attention. The formal analysis is based on temporal relational specifications for attentional states and for different stages of attentional processes. The model has been automatically verified against these specifications. © Springer-Verlag Berlin Heidelberg 2007.
